Born in
Concepción, Rojas began his career with
Cerro Porteño. In April 2013, he signed a 5-year contract with Portuguese club
Benfica, joining at the start of the 2013–14 season. After playing for
Benfica B in the
Segunda Liga, he was loaned to
Belenenses in January 2014 for the rest of the season. On 8 July 2014, Rojas was loaned to Argentine club
Gimnasia LP until December 2015. He made 51 appearances and scored 5 goals for Gimnasia between July 2014 and December 2015. Upon his arrival back to Benfica he was again sent out on loan, as he joined former club Cerro Porteño. In January 2019 Rojas signed for Mexican club
Querétaro. On 24 June 2019,
Tijuana announced his signing on a 18 months loan. On 3 January 2020, Rojas returned to Paraguay, joining
Club Olimpia. On 9 June 2021, he joined
Sol de América. On 22 July 2022, Rojas returned to Paraguay joining
Sportivo Ameliano, after a failed stint at
Metalist Kharkiv due to the start of the
